605606552051 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 605606552052. Its totient is φ = 605606552050.

The previous prime is 605606552039. The next prime is 605606552063. The reversal of 605606552051 is 150255606506.

It is a balanced prime because it is at equal distance from previous prime (605606552039) and next prime (605606552063).

It is a cyclic number.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 605606552051 - 210 = 605606551027 is a prime.

It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(605606552011) by changing a digit.

It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(19) of ones.

It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 302803276025 + 302803276026.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(302803276026).
